// ReadAncientTxLookupProgress retrieves the number of ancient blocks which
// txlookup has been inserted to allow reporting correct numbers across restarts.
func ReadAncientTxLookupProgress(db ethdb.KeyValueReader) *uint64 {
data, _ := db.Get(ancientTxLookupProgressKey)
if len(data) != 8 {
return nil
}
number := binary.BigEndian.Uint64(data)
return &number
}
// WriteAncientTxLookupProgress stores the ancient txlookup process counter to support
// retrieving it across restarts.
func WriteAncientTxLookupProgress(db ethdb.KeyValueWriter, number uint64) {
if err := db.Put(ancientTxLookupProgressKey, encodeBlockNumber(number)); err != nil {
log.Crit("Failed to store head number of txlookup", "err", err)
}
}
// DeleteAncientTxLookupProgress deletes the ancient txlookup progress.
func DeleteAncientTxLookupProgress(db ethdb.KeyValueWriter) {
if err := db.Delete(ancientTxLookupProgressKey); err != nil {
log.Crit("Failed to delete ancient txlookup progress entry", "err", err)
}
}

// InitTxsLookupFromFreezer initializes txlookup indexes in the database.
func InitTxsLookupFromFreezer(db ethdb.Database, from uint64) error {
// hashTxs calculates transaction hash in advance using the multi-routine's
// concurrent computing power.
hashTxs := func(block *types.Block) {
for _, tx := range block.Transactions() {
tx.Hash()
}
}
// writeIndex injects txlookup indexes into the database.
writeIndex := func(batch ethdb.Batch, block *types.Block) {
WriteTxLookupEntries(batch, block)
if block.NumberU64()%10000 == 0 {
WriteAncientTxLookupProgress(batch, block.NumberU64())
}
}
if err := iterateAncient(db, from, "txlookup", hashTxs, writeIndex); err != nil {
return err
}
DeleteAncientTxLookupProgress(db) // Mark all txlookup indexes of ancient blocks have been inserted.
return nil
}
